    Default Hand replayer not opening

    Nothing happens when I click on replay hand/replay selected hands/replay all hands, or double klick on a hand.
    I updated HEM, still nothing.

    I would do a full re-install but I have so many settings that I don't want to loose...
    Anything else I could try besides a clean re-install? Can I send some log files or similar?

    Which site are the hands from?

    Please give HoldemManager Administrator rights -

    1) Go to C:\Program Files\RVG Software\Holdem Manager (Program Files (x86) if you have the 64bit version)
    2) Right-click the HoldemManager.exe and choose "Properties".
    3) Go to the Compatibility Tab and select "Run this program as an Administrator".
    4) Do the same for HMImport.exe, HMHud.exe and DBControlPanel.exe


    *Try creating a new UTF DB - http://faq.holdemmanager.com/questio...elete+Database
    *Now import a small portion of your \HMArchive so you can see if the problem exists in the new DB - http://faq.holdemmanager.com/questio...6+Export+Hands
    *If the new DB seems to work properly, you will want to import the rest of your archives to the new DB, export/import the hands from the old DB to the new DB, and export/import any player notes and tourney summaries - and then delete the old DB.
    *Make sure you export/backup everything before deleting the old DB - http://faq.holdemmanager.com/questio...+-+Backup+Tips


    If you continue to have problems, Please zip and email the problem hand histories, with a link to this thread and your forum name, to support@holdemmanager.com


    If you want to try a reinstall you can backup the settings manually.


    http://faq.holdemmanager.com/questio...o+Uninstaller+

    http://faq.holdemmanager.com/questio...g+Preferences+

    1) Export any custom HUD configs individually, make a backup of your C:\Program Files\RVG Software\Holdem Manager\Config folder, and any other important files. If you have custom filters/reports/stats, just copy the entire \holdem manager folder before uninstalling.

    2) Uninstall HM with Revo Uninstaller Pro - Uninstall Software, Remove Programs easily, Forced Uninstall, Leftovers Uninstaller using the Deep setting. You do not need to uninstall PostgreSQL.
    3) If given the option, on the 2 following screens of Revo, remove any registry entries and leftover files. If you have Holdem Manager 2 installed do not delete any folders in C:\Users\[Username]\AppData\Roaming\HoldemManager. If Windows XP - C:\Documents and Settings\[Username]\Application Data\HoldemManager.
    4) Reboot your computer
    5) Install the complete setup of HM: http://www.holdemmanager.com/downloa...ager_Setup.exe. You should un-check the PostgreSQL Option when running the combo installer.
    6) Test if it for a while and see if it works

    Okay, contacted email support and tried everything except a complete re-install.
    Problem is there is no uninstall.exe in the holdemmanager directory, and HEM is not listed in the Revo-Uninstaller list or windows 'Programs and Features' list....

    What do I do now?

    It sounds like you might have installed originally using an update patch instead of a full setup file which would explain the replayer problems.

    Run this full setup file - http://www.holdemmanager.com/downloa...ager_Setup.exe

    Then update with the latest patch - http://forums.holdemmanager.com/rele...m1-update.html

    See if that solves the replayer issues and if the problems persist you should be able to do a proper uninstall/reinstall now.
